Abstract

A specific aspect of the life of journeymen, beggars and robbers in presented with the help of three the minutes of three police and judicial proceedings dating back to the late 18th century and early 19th century. The stories of the fate of the three individuals in question also depict how the legal system at the time was in the process of gradually abolishing the high-handedness of individual landed property owners as well as of the state officials.
